Sanjay Raut Criticizes Eknath Shinde Government Over Missing CCTV Footage in Badlapur Sexual Abuse Case

Mumbai: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Sanjay Raut launched a scathing attack on the Eknath Shinde-led Maharashtra government on Wednesday, demanding answers about the disappearance of crucial CCTV footage related to the ongoing Badlapur sexual abuse case.

Addressing a press conference, Raut expressed frustration over the lack of action and transparency from the state government, particularly targeting Chief Minister Eknath Shinde and Home Minister Devendra Fadnavis. “The Chief Minister and Home Minister are silent about this issue while we are raising it. Who is responsible for making the CCTV footage disappear from the school? Was it the head of the institution trying to cover up something? Why was this footage removed? Is there a larger conspiracy at play?” Raut questioned.

The controversy erupted last month when Maharashtra Minister and Shiv Sena leader Deepak Kesarkar disclosed that CCTV footage from the Badlapur school, where two minor girls were allegedly sexually assaulted, had vanished. Kesarkar underscored the urgency of investigating the disappearance and understanding the motives behind it. He also suggested the installation of panic buttons in schools as a precautionary measure to enhance safety.

The Badlapur case, involving the alleged assault of two four-year-old girls, has sparked widespread outrage and led to multiple protests across the state. On August 31, a Thane Court granted approval for a Special Investigating Team (SIT) to conduct a test identification parade of the accused. This allowed the survivors to identify their alleged abusers under the supervision of an Executive Magistrate. The SIT has also developed a psychological profile of the suspects to aid in the ongoing investigation.

In response to the crisis, the Bombay High Court proposed the formation of a committee to create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) for police, hospitals, and schools in handling sexual assault cases involving minors.

The situation remains tense as the investigation continues. The police had previously arrested a school attendant in connection with the alleged abuse, but questions about the missing CCTV footage and the government's role in the incident continue to fuel public scrutiny and demand for justice.
